Python笔记1

python +selenium web自动化(功能测试转换为代码)
python +appium 移动端(手机端app)自动化
python +requests 接口

Python基础

Python 介绍

作者:吉多·范罗苏姆(Guido van Rossum)龟叔
1989年开始书写,1991年诞生

  • 为什么学习python?
    • 简单、易学、免费、开源,适用人群广泛
    • 应用领域广泛(自动化测试)
  • python 的版本
    • pyhon2(2.x 2.7)
    • python3(主流使用的版本,3.6之后的版本(即大于等于3.6))

语言的分类

计算机只认识 二进制(0和1)
编程语言是人和计算机沟通的语言
编程语言分类:编译型语言,解释型语言

任何一门编程语言书写的代码,想让计算机认识都需要转换为二进制
编译器软件:将书写的代码转换为一个二进制文件,代码存在编写错误,就不能产生中间文件
解释器(软件):在代码执行的时候,将代码转换为二进制,边执行边转换(解释),代码从上到下执行,后续代码的错误,不影响前边代码的执行

编译型:一次性将全部的代码编译成二进制文件。(c、c++)
优点:运行效率高
缺点:开发速度慢,不能跨平台

解释型:当程序运行时, 从上至下一行一行的解释成二进制。(python)
优点:开发速度快,效率高,可以跨平台
缺点:运行效率低

使用 pycharm 书写代码

  1. 创建新项目
    请添加图片描述
  2. 配置项目的路径和解释器
    请添加图片描述
  3. 创建代码文件书写代码
    python 文件的后缀是 .py
    代码要顶格书写
    代码中的标点符号要使用英文状态的标点
    请添加图片描述
  4. 运行代码文件
    请添加图片描述
  5. 查看代码运行结果请添加图片描述

pycharm的常见设置

  1. 设置背景色
    请添加图片描述
  2. 设置代码的字体和大小
    请添加图片描述
  3. 右键菜单的使用
    请添加图片描述
  4. 设置解释器
    请添加图片描述
    请添加图片描述
    请添加图片描述
  • 3
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值